## Authentication

The Glintkit component library publishes versioned bundles to our internal registry. Each release is signed, and the registry rejects unauthenticated pulls of pre-release versions. Reviewers verifying a version bump should fetch the candidate bundle directly. For that request, pass the bearer token provided immediately below.

portal login ticket: eyJhbGciOiJIUzI1NiIsInR5cCI6IkpXVCJ9.eyJzdWIiOiIMjvRAf3PEFIn0.nuv9gjixLtnr

Retries happen — networks flake, clients time out. That's why every payment call to the Penniwick API takes an `Idempotency-Key` header; replaying the same key returns the original result instead of charging twice. Keys expire after 24 hours, so generate a fresh UUID per logical attempt. To try this in the sandbox, authenticate with the bearer token below.

portal login ticket: eyJhbGciOiJIUzI1NiIsInR5cCI6IkpXVCJ9.eyJzdWIiOiIwEOsktwVNwIn0.-UJU3fdyyCgG

## Deployment

ProseGate, our documentation linter, ships as a single container promoted through the Quillmark pipeline. Before tagging a release, confirm the rule bundle version matches the one approved in the style council minutes, since mismatched bundles will fail builds across every downstream repo. Deploy to the staging cluster first, run the smoke suite against the sample corpus, and watch error rates for ten minutes. The staging instance reads the following configuration values.

settings of yageg-yahap:
[gorael]
team = olieth
access_code = ac_941d74
owner = brieth.aldiel
host = gorael.tolvaqio.internal
port = 6379
peer = briwyn.urlaqtech.internal
salt = 116e6622
pin = 1957